Вот что у нас дома:
- Рабочий стол с Win7
- Ноутбук с Win7
- Основной NAS с 1 ГБ памяти
- Вторичный NAS с 2 ГБ хранилища используется для резервного копирования основного NAS, настольного компьютера и ноутбука
Я настраиваю непрерывное резервное копирование с настольного компьютера, ноутбука и основного NAS на дополнительный NAS с помощью Oops Backup с 1-часовым расписанием.
Прекрасно работает для резервного копирования, однако мы бы хотели, чтобы все наши данные были на основном NAS, а все компьютеры были бы прозрачно синхронизированы с ним.
Я знаю, что могу использовать программу, которая выполняет двухстороннюю (даже трехстороннюю) синхронизацию, но я не уверен, безопасно ли это делать.
Давайте иметь несколько сценариев:
Сценарий № 1
Я редактирую документ Word на ноутбуке, и когда я сохраняю документ, он должен быть скопирован на NAS.
Настольный компьютер увидит, что документ изменился на NAS, и синхронизируется с ним.
Однако, если документ изменился на рабочем столе, то нам нужен способ либо заблокировать заранее, либо получить предупреждение о конфликте при синхронизации.
Из того, что я знаю, Word накладывает некоторую блокировку на файл (он даже создает некоторые временные файлы)... Будет ли достаточно синхронизировать эти файлы с NAS, а затем с другим компьютером? Будет ли это заблокировать файл на другом компьютере?
Сценарий № 2
Я редактирую TXT-файл на рабочем столе. То же, что в сценарии № 1, но без механизма блокировки. Как насчет этого?
В основном все сводится к тому, чтобы заблокировать кого-то еще. Я мог бы использовать программу контроля версий, но я хочу что-то прозрачное.
Есть идеи?
РЕДАКТИРОВАТЬ: забыл добавить, что я хочу иметь возможность доступа к файлам в автономном режиме с NAS (например, когда я вынимаю ноутбук из дома).